Prostate cancer is the most common cancer in men, with 52,000 men being diagnosed every year in the UK. That’s 143 men a day. The Royal Marsden opened its doors in 1851 as the world’s first hospital dedicated to cancer diagnosis, treatment, research and education. Together, The Royal Marsden and its principle academic partner, the Institute of Cancer Research are ranked in the top five cancer centres in the world for the impact of their research, treating over 59,000 NHS and private patients every year.  Trials being conducted, like the trial my Dad entered, are changing lives and constantly working to find new information on all Cancers.
